Why This Study Matters
Cervical cancer carries a steep survival drop once disease spreads beyond the pelvis: overall five-year relative survival across all stages is 68.8%, but falls to 20.5% for distant, metastatic-stage disease. The National Cancer Institute projects roughly 13,490 new U.S. cervical cancer diagnoses and 4,200 deaths in 2026, underscoring why durable first-line systemic therapy in persistent, recurrent, or metastatic disease remains a priority.
Pembrolizumab plus platinum-based chemotherapy, with or without bevacizumab, was the first anti-PD-1/PD-L1-based regimen to show a significant survival benefit in this setting, and it received FDA approval in October 2021 for tumors with a PD-L1 combined positive score (CPS) of 1 or higher. This ad hoc exploratory analysis asks whether that benefit has held up over a longer stretch of follow-up.
Study Design
KEYNOTE-826 is a phase 3, double-blind, randomized, placebo-controlled trial conducted at 151 sites across 19 countries. Patients with previously untreated persistent, recurrent, or metastatic cervical cancer were randomized to pembrolizumab 200 mg intravenously every 3 weeks (for up to 35 cycles) plus platinum-based chemotherapy with or without bevacizumab, or to placebo plus the same chemotherapy backbone. Enrollment ran from November 20, 2018, to January 31, 2020. This exploratory analysis reflects a median follow-up of 59.1 months (range, 52.1–66.5), compared with 39.1 months at the trial's prior final analysis.
Patient Population
Among the 617 randomized patients, median age was 51.0 years (range, 22–82). At diagnosis, 303 patients (49.1%) had stage I/II disease and 190 (30.8%) had stage IVB disease; 446 patients (72.3%) had squamous cell carcinoma histology.
Efficacy Results
Both overall survival and progression-free survival continued to favor the pembrolizumab combination at this extended follow-up, in both the PD-L1 CPS≥1 population and the overall intention-to-treat population.
| Endpoint | Population | Pembrolizumab Arm | Placebo Arm | Hazard Ratio (95% CI) |
|---|---|---|---|---|
| Overall survival | PD-L1 CPS≥1 | 28.6 mo | 16.5 mo | 0.62 (0.50–0.76) |
| Overall survival | Intention-to-treat | 26.4 mo | 16.8 mo | 0.64 (0.53–0.78) |
| Progression-free survival | PD-L1 CPS≥1 | 10.5 mo | 8.2 mo | 0.58 (0.48–0.71) |
| Progression-free survival | Intention-to-treat | 10.4 mo | 8.2 mo | 0.61 (0.51–0.74) |
The published abstract for this exploratory analysis does not report p-values for these 5-year hazard ratios, and none are stated here to avoid fabricating a statistic the source does not provide. For context only, and not from this analysis: the original 2021 interim data underlying FDA approval reported, in the PD-L1 CPS≥1 population (n=548), median overall survival not reached versus 16.3 months (hazard ratio 0.64) and median progression-free survival 10.4 versus 8.2 months (hazard ratio 0.62).

Safety Profile
No new safety signals were observed at this roughly five-year follow-up, and no additional treatment-related deaths had occurred since the trial's prior final analysis.

Interpretation and Broader Context
The 5-year data confirm the durability of benefit and reinforce pembrolizumab plus chemotherapy, with or without bevacizumab, as a first-line standard-of-care option for recurrent and metastatic cervical cancer.
— Conclusions and Relevance, Hasegawa et al., JAMA Oncology, September 10, 2026
Taken together with the trial's original 2021 primary-endpoint results and its 2023 final analysis, this exploratory look at roughly five years of follow-up suggests the survival advantage seen early in KEYNOTE-826 has persisted as the cohort has matured, rather than fading as early responders were counted more than once. The authors themselves note that long-term follow-up is important to further inform the benefit-risk profile of anticancer treatments — a reminder that this durability data, while reassuring, is an exploratory analysis layered on top of the trial's original pre-specified endpoints, not a new confirmatory readout.
Limitations
This is an ad hoc exploratory analysis, not a pre-specified confirmatory one: the published abstract reports no p-values for the 5-year overall survival or progression-free survival hazard ratios, so the size of any statistical effect beyond the point estimates and confidence intervals cannot be judged here. In an ad hoc exploratory analysis of KEYNOTE-826 at roughly five years of follow-up (median 59.1 months), adding pembrolizumab to platinum-based chemotherapy, with or without bevacizumab, continued to show longer overall survival (28.6 vs 16.5 months in the PD-L1 CPS≥1 population; hazard ratio 0.62) and progression-free survival than chemotherapy alone in persistent, recurrent, or metastatic cervical cancer, with no new safety signals.
